Mathematical model of a fountain with a water picture in the shape of an hourglass
The work presents a mathematical model of a fountain providing an hourglass-shaped water image based on four of its basic parameters: height H, coefficient of contraction χ, diameter of n nozzles arrangement Dna, and coefficient of contraction location σ.
